Pope France, preparing for his three-nation African safari starting midweek, was late for his traditional address to the crowds on St Peter’s Square yesterday.

He’s been stuck in a lift in the Vatican for 25 minutes and had to be recused by firefighters.

From his balcony overlooking the throng on St Peter’s Square, Pope Francis apologized for being late for his customary Sunday meeting with the masses.

He explained he had been stuck in a lift which he has had been caused by a drop in tension of the the electricity. 

The pontiff asked the faithful to applaud the firemen who had rescued him.

In his address he said the world was undergoing a climate emergency and urged governments to take drastic measures to stop global warming.

President Cyril Ramaphosa says the signing of a peace accord in Mozambique paves the way for free elections in South Africa’s eastern neighbour in November.

President Felipe Nyusi and Renamo’s Ossufo Momade inked the deal in Maputo yesterday.

This is the second time Renamo has formalized  a peace deal with Mozambique’s Frelimo Government.

The late Afonso Dhlakama signed the first in Rome 26 years ago after the Vatican mediated an end to the 16-year civil war that brought the country to its knees.

Losing successive elections drove Renamo to take up weapons and go back into the bush.

Yesterday’s peace follows the death last year of Dhlakama.

Guests at yesterday’s signing, including President Cyril Ramaphosa and his Rwandan counterpart Paul Kagame,  heard that Renamo plans to do better in October’s election.

Two Italian priests and a Canadian nun seized by Boko Haram gunmen in Cameroon two months ago have been flown back to the capital, Yaounde.

Their kidnapping, on April 5 follows Boko Haram’s abduction in Cameroon last year of a priest and seven members of a French family.

 

The Italian foreign ministry confirms the release of Italian priests Gianantonio Allegri and Giampaolo Marta and Canadian nun Gilberte Bussier

It hasn’t given detailed of how they were freed.

But it thanks the Canadian and Cameroon authorities.

In addition to their religious tasks, the priests were improving water supplies and fighting the spread of HIV Aids.

Cameroon’s despatched 1 000 troops to its border with Nigeria to fight the growing threat from Boko Haram.
